WebIn terms of Section 46 of the Tribunal (Scotland) Act 2014, a party aggrieved by the decision of the Tribunal may appeal to the Upper Tribunal for Scotland on a point of law only. Before an appeal can be made to the Upper Tribunal, the party must first seek permission to appeal from the First-tier Tribunal. WebYour landlord cannot make you leave without an eviction order from the First-tier Tribunal for Scotland (Housing and Property Chamber). They cannot apply for an order until the notice period on your eviction notice expires. The tribunal makes eviction decisions. WebThe First-tier Tribunal for Scotland deals with first instance decisions. These are cases heard at a tribunal for the first time. The Upper Tribunal primarily hears cases that are appealed from the First-tier Tribunal. …
